Overview

The GameKing, also known as Dai Dai Xing Game King, is a handheld gaming console released in September 2004 by the Chinese brand Dai Dai Xing. It features a simple, horizontal form factor with a translucent light gray-green plastic shell. Powered by a 65C02 processor clocked at 6 MHz, it offers a basic gaming experience on a small 48x32 pixel LCD screen with a 3:2 aspect ratio and 60 Hz refresh rate.

Key Specs Highlights

  • CPU: 65C02 @ 6 MHz
  • Screen: 48x32 LCD, 3:2 aspect ratio, 60 Hz
  • Body: Plastic, horizontal grip
  • Color: Translucent light gray-green
  • Release: September 2004
